Iran Rejects US Claims, Promises Escalated Attacks on America, Israel
The announcement followed a televised address by U.S. President Donald Trump from the White House, in which he stated that Iran had “very few” missile launchers remaining and that its ability to deploy missiles and drones had been “dramatically curtailed.” Trump added that he anticipates the conflict to last another two to three weeks but expects it is nearing its conclusion.
Responding to these claims, a spokesperson for Iran’s Khatam al-Anbiya Central Headquarters said that U.S. and Israeli assessments of Iran’s military power are inaccurate. “As we said, we announce to the Zionist-American enemies that your information about our military power and equipment is incomplete. You are completely ignorant of our enormous and strategic capabilities,” the spokesperson stated.
The spokesperson rejected assertions that Iran’s missile production facilities and advanced systems had been neutralized. “Do not think that you have destroyed our strategic missile production centers, our long-range offensive drones, modern air defense and electronic warfare systems, or our special equipment -- because such assumptions will only make matters worse,” he said.
He added that Iran continues strategic military production in undisclosed locations, keeping it beyond the reach of its adversaries, according to reports.
